blub

Other forms: blubbing; blubbed

Definitions of blub
  1. verb
    cry or whine with snuffling
    synonyms: blubber, sniffle, snivel, snuffle
    see moresee less
    type of:
    cry, weep
    shed tears because of sadness, rage, or pain
